Desiccant Dehumidification Cost In Lakes of Savannah, TX
The cost of Desiccant Dehumidification services in Lakes of Savannah, TX can vary dep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Here are some estimated price ranges: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Desiccant Dehumidification |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
| Equipment Rental | $100 – $500 | Duration of rental, type of equipment |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ning products used |
| Repair or Replacement of Damaged Materials | $500 – $5,000 | Type of materials damaged, extent of damage |
| Insurance Claims Help | $100 – $1,000 | Severity of damage, complexity of claims process |
